• B правой части каждого сообщения есть стрелки и . Не стесняйтесь оценивать ответы. Чтобы автору вопроса закрыть свой тикет, надо выбрать лучший ответ. Просто нажмите значок в правой части сообщения.

osmocom

zxv_zz

Well-known member
26.12.2019
97
0
BIT
15
Привет форумчани! Помогите разобраться, при установки libosmocom, а точнее после выполнения команды ./configure получаю следующую ошибку "configure: error sctp_bindx not found in searched libs", установлен Kali заранее благодарен, и всех с наступающим!
 

alfabuster

Green Team
04.11.2019
118
12
BIT
19
Привет форумчани! Помогите разобраться, при установки libosmocom, а точнее после выполнения команды ./configure получаю следующую ошибку "configure: error sctp_bindx not found in searched libs", установлен Kali заранее благодарен, и всех с наступающим!
Скорее всего не хватает библиотек

apt install libsctp-dev

Но это не точно. Вообще перед компиляцией в документации обычно пишут все зависимости, которые нужны для успешного завершения.
 

zxv_zz

Well-known member
26.12.2019
97
0
BIT
15
Благодарю что отозвался! Попробую отпишу.

Скорее всего не хватает библиотек

apt install libsctp-dev

Но это не точно. Вообще перед компиляцией в документации обычно пишут все зависимости, которые нужны для успешного завершения.

Успешно установилось, дальше снова посыпалось на установке toolchain.

ледующие пакеты имеют неудовлетворённые зависимости:
libncurses5-dbg : Зависит: libtinfo5 (= 6.0+20161126-1+deb9u2) но 6.1+20191019-1 должен быть установлен
Зависит: libncurses5 (= 6.0+20161126-1+deb9u2) но 6.1+20191019-1 должен быть установлен
Зависит: libtinfo5-dbg (= 6.0+20161126-1+deb9u2) но он не будет установлен
libncursesw5-dbg : Зависит: libtinfo5 (= 6.0+20161126-1+deb9u2) но 6.1+20191019-1 должен быть установлен
Зависит: libtinfo5-dbg (= 6.0+20161126-1+deb9u2) но он не будет установлен
Зависит: libncursesw5 (= 6.0+20161126-1+deb9u2) но 6.1+20191019-1 должен быть установлен
E: Невозможно исправить ошибки: у вас зафиксированы сломанные пакеты.

Успешно установилось, дальше снова посыпалось на установке toolchain.

ледующие пакеты имеют неудовлетворённые зависимости:
libncurses5-dbg : Зависит: libtinfo5 (= 6.0+20161126-1+deb9u2) но 6.1+20191019-1 должен быть установлен
Зависит: libncurses5 (= 6.0+20161126-1+deb9u2) но 6.1+20191019-1 должен быть установлен
Зависит: libtinfo5-dbg (= 6.0+20161126-1+deb9u2) но он не будет установлен
libncursesw5-dbg : Зависит: libtinfo5 (= 6.0+20161126-1+deb9u2) но 6.1+20191019-1 должен быть установлен
Зависит: libtinfo5-dbg (= 6.0+20161126-1+deb9u2) но он не будет установлен
Зависит: libncursesw5 (= 6.0+20161126-1+deb9u2) но 6.1+20191019-1 должен быть установлен
E: Невозможно исправить ошибки: у вас зафиксированы сломанные пакеты.

Убрал обозначенные пакеты из кода, прошло все дальше.

Успешно установились osmocombb и FFT, а вот на libosmo-dsp получаю следующие:
make
make all-recursive
make[1]: вход в каталог «/root/libosmo-dsp»
Making all in include
make[2]: вход в каталог «/root/libosmo-dsp/include»
Making all in osmocom
make[3]: вход в каталог «/root/libosmo-dsp/include/osmocom»
Making all in dsp
make[4]: вход в каталог «/root/libosmo-dsp/include/osmocom/dsp»
make[4]: Цель «all» не требует выполнения команд.
make[4]: выход из каталога «/root/libosmo-dsp/include/osmocom/dsp»
make[4]: вход в каталог «/root/libosmo-dsp/include/osmocom»
make[4]: Цель «all-am» не требует выполнения команд.
make[4]: выход из каталога «/root/libosmo-dsp/include/osmocom»
make[3]: выход из каталога «/root/libosmo-dsp/include/osmocom»
make[3]: вход в каталог «/root/libosmo-dsp/include»
make[3]: Цель «all-am» не требует выполнения команд.
make[3]: выход из каталога «/root/libosmo-dsp/include»
make[2]: выход из каталога «/root/libosmo-dsp/include»
Making all in src
make[2]: вход в каталог «/root/libosmo-dsp/src»
CC iqbal.lo
CCLD libosmodsp.la
/usr/bin/ld: /usr/local/lib/libfftw3f.a(assert.o): relocation R_X86_64_PC32 against symbol `stdout@@GLIBC_2.2.5' can not be used when making a shared object; recompile with -fPIC
/usr/bin/ld: final link failed: bad value
collect2: error: ld returned 1 exit status
make[2]: *** [Makefile:410: libosmodsp.la] Ошибка 1
make[2]: выход из каталога «/root/libosmo-dsp/src»
make[1]: *** [Makefile:488: all-recursive] Ошибка 1
make[1]: выход из каталога «/root/libosmo-dsp»
make: *** [Makefile:374: all] Ошибка 2

Всем спасибо за внимание, osmocom работает. Ubuntu 16.04

B25BF995-4E3A-4744-BBD9-02E72EA678B5.jpeg 35B3802E-0226-4870-A42E-67F219CCD6F2.jpeg 587FD85E-8FA6-4D5F-9C49-EECE1D34E098.jpeg
 
Мы в соцсетях:

Обучение наступательной кибербезопасности в игровой форме. Начать игру!